How hard is it to cancel Wellhub (Gympass)?
Wellhub (Gympass) scores 79/100 (grade B) for how clearly it documents cancellation in the US — a clearly documented cancellation policy. Cancellation is available via online (self-serve), in-app.
Cancellation is self-serve via the Wellhub app (Profile > Settings > Account > Manage Subscription > Cancel Subscription) or via web account, with a dedicated cancel portal at subscription-management.gympass.com/cancel. Cancellation must be completed at least 3 business days before the next billing date to avoid being charged for the following cycle; the plan remains active through the end of the current paid period. Wellhub explicitly states no refunds or credits are issued upon cancellation and no proration applies for unused days in the current period. There are no enrollment or cancellation fees.
How to cancel Wellhub (Gympass)
- Channels: online (self-serve), in-app
- Official cancellation page: https://helpcenter.gympass.com/en-us/articles/how-do-i-cancel-my-plan-or-a-family-members-plan
- Pause/freeze: available — Pause available via the app (Profile > Settings > Account > Manage Subscription > Pause Subscription). The pause takes effect the following day; the plan auto-reactivates on the selected return date. Pausing the primary account does not automatically pause family-member plans — each must be paused separately.
- Account/data deletion: Account deletion available in-app under Privacy and Security > Personal Data > Request Account Deletion. Password confirmation required. Wellhub states it responds within 24 working hours. Deletion removes all personal data and the account cannot be reused. https://helpcenter.gympass.com/en-us/articles/how-to-delete-your-gympass-account

Scope & fairness
This is the Documented-Policy tier: it measures how clearly the cancellation policy is published (cited, dated facts), not the behavioural experience of cancelling (Verified-Flow audit pending). Every company is scored on the same five dimensions with the same published weights — scores cannot be bought or removed. It is opinion grounded in disclosed facts, and not legal advice.
